A 14-year-old Indiana boy who disappeared last week while walking his dog was found dead Tuesday.

Jacob McCarty was last seen Sept. 21 near his hometown of Corydon in southern Indiana, police said. His father said he left that day to walk his German shepherd, Isabella, and never returned.

As police investigated, they learned of video that showed Jacob and Isabella walking along Interstate 64, just north of Corydon, around 5 p.m. on Sept. 21, according to a Facebook post from the Harrison County Sheriff’s Department.

Officers searched the area and located Jacob’s body in the woods near Harrison County Hospital. Isabella was found dead next to Jacob.

Police do not suspect foul play in Jacob’s death. The Harrison County Coroner will perform an autopsy to determine his cause of death.
